Exactly. They’ve been doing it since 2005/06. If it didn’t make them money then they wouldn’t do it. They are a business first and foremost. They tweak it to suite them, removing starters, tips included, desserts etc and adding alcohol and extra snack credits and even recently the breakfast credit. Never believed they’ve been trying to get rid of it. If they wanted to they’d just do it. I don’t think they were planning on removing it however Covid changes things. I don’t think free dining will be back for 2022 as there are too many uncertainties and cost cutting measures in place until the pandemic is done. I’m sure it will be back at some point.

At the moment free dining, and dining plans in general, are not happening. As far as anyone knows there are no immediate plans to reinstate them. Whether free dining will return sometime in the future is anyone's guess.
Free dining was certainly popular with UK guests, and I think for many USA guests as well. In recent years there was a queue just to get onto the Disney UK website when free dining became available. It helped to sell a lot of (overpriced) onsite stays. It was a major factor in us chosing to stay onsite. But, at the moment whilst this pandemic is going on, the incentive for Disney to cram as many people into their hotels as possible isn't there. So there's no need for them to offer free dining and the like right now. But in a couple of years time, I would hope things will be different and then Disney may start offering incentives to stay onsite again.
